What is the most popular drink during the holidays?

There are many different drinks that people tend to enjoy during the holiday season. Some of the most popular choices include eggnog, hot chocolate, mulled wine, and cider.

Eggnog is a drink that is made with milk, eggs, sugar, and spices. It is usually served cold or warmed up, and is a popular choice during the winter holidays.

Hot chocolate is a drink that is made with chocolate, milk, and sugar. It can be enjoyed with or without whipped cream, and is a popular choice when it is cold outside.

Mulled wine is a drink that is made with red wine, sugar, spices, and sometimes fruit. It is served warm, and is a popular choice during the winter holidays.

Cider is a drink that is made with apples, sugar, and spices. It is served cold or warm, and is a popular choice during the fall and winter holidays.

What are some fancy drink names?

Do you enjoy mixing up cocktails at home? If so, you may be looking for some new and interesting drink names to try out. Here are a few ideas:

1. The Blue Lagoon. This drink is made with vodka, blue curacao, and lemonade.

2. The Chocolate Covered Strawberry. This drink is made with vodka, strawberry Schnapps, and chocolate milk.

3. The Peachy Keen. This drink is made with vodka, peach schnapps, and cranberry juice.

4. The Pina Colada. This drink is made with rum, pineapple juice, and coconut milk.

5. The Dirty Shirley. This drink is made with vodka, Shirley Temple mix, and grenadine.

6. The Margarita. This drink is made with tequila, lime juice, and orange liqueur.

7. The Mojito. This drink is made with white rum, lime juice, sugar, and mint leaves.

8. The Old Fashioned. This drink is made with bourbon, sugar, and bitters.

9. The Singapore Sling. This drink is made with gin, cherry brandy, pineapple juice, and lime juice.

10. The Tom Collins. This drink is made with gin, lemon juice, sugar, and club soda.
